Clarence Alley "Clay" Thompson IV (born May 4, 1992) is an American professional tennis player. Thompson attended Crossroads High School in Santa Monica, CA and later attended UCLA for 4 years. Thompson was the number 1 ranked NCAA singles player in the nation his senior year at UCLA. Thompson also won the CIF individual title his senior year representing Crossroads High School. Clay's playing style consists of big hitting and serve and volley. Thompson received a wildcard into the 2014 Hall of Fame Tennis Championships, losing to Steve Johnson in the first round.
